Coldwell Banker's MLS Listed Cartoon House Foreclosed Upon


I've written about the 940 Hillcrest cartoon house for a while now - how it was a Coldwell Banker listing priced at (hold your laughter) $2,800,000. The original MLS listing didn't even have a picture of the house, it had a nice fancy cartoon drawn house drawn over the present house.

This was the ultimate bubble listing. It wasn't about the house that existed in REALITY - instead the brokerage wanted everyone to buy into a fantasy cartoon house that only existed in the MLS. After all, that's where the value is - in pretend homes. Gee, thanks, Coldwell Banker.

Well, the sales tactics didn't work and its all over now. According to the new MLS listing that hit the system today, the property is now bank owned and priced at $937,800, roughly 66% less than Coldwell Banker's original price. I'm really happy for the buyers out there who didn't fall prey to the original list price.
